Add support for [string byterange]
Sometimes it may be necessary to extract bytes directly from a UTF-8 string. [string byterange] is like [string range] except it works on bytes rather than characters if the string is a UTF-8 string. Signed-off-by: Steve Bennett <steveb@workware.net.au>
